Overview
The Intercultural Studies Master is offered by Palm Beach Atlantic University. The MA in Intercultural Studies at Palm Beach Atlantic University offers the opportunity for advanced theological engagement with pressing missiological questions in light of Scripture and the rich heritage of Christian faith and practice.
Key Facts
Our context is important to us. We recognize and draw on the valuable resources offered by our location in South Florida. Few places are better situated for a truly intercultural and interconfessional education. Over 68 percent of the population is comprised of ethnic and racial minorities, and half of all residents speak a language other than English. PBA’s interculturally experienced faculty represent this same diversity along with a unique depth of cultural and missiological experience and training. Our welcoming community will provide opportunities for you to interact with classmates and professors from around the world. You will enhance your understanding of world Christianity and learn practical skills for ministering more effectively in pluralistic societies in the U.S. and around the world.
Programme Structure
Courses include:
- The expectation is that student will be able to complete the degree program within two years. Two classes will be offered per semester; fall and spring courses will be eight-weeks online (one at a time, A and B terms), and summer classes will be four weeks each (A and B terms) and include one-week seminars on campus in West Palm Beach and Orlando (two weeks total). Thus, summer courses will consist of an online and on campus component.

Other requirements
General requirements
- A completed online application* and $45 nonrefundable fee (Click on the drop-down arrow to select the Graduate application)
- Official transcript from college/university where bachelor’s degree was conferred and from college/university where prerequisite courses were taken
- Two specific confidential recommendations (academic and ministerial)
- Two specific writing samples (requirements will be provided)
- Informed consent form
